Smart Port Establishment to Foster Global Maritime, Land, and Air Logistics Data Flow

The Government will launch the Port Community System (PCS) next year. The PCS will leverage artificial intelligence, big data, and blockchain technologies to facilitate maritime, land, and air logistics data flow, and foster the interconnectivity of information flow with ports in the Mainland and overseas. Given numerous logistics enterprises have established individual logistics data platforms, what is the significance of developing a PCS?

PCS Establishment Smash "Information Silos" in Logistics Sector


With a diversified industrial culture, the logistics sector comprises enterprises operating across various segments. For the sake of confidentiality and commercial interests, information systems among the enterprises are not seamlessly accessible, resulting in issues such as fragmented information and a lack of unified data standards, which form mutually disconnected "information silos". As a result, cargo owners encounter difficulties in tracking cargo throughout the entire logistics process, complicating inventory management and supply-chain oversight, and increasing the costs for financial institutions in verifying trade information.  Consequently, overall trade costs remain consistently high.

The PCS is a vital infrastructure that bridges these "information silos" for the logistics sector. Since the 1980s, customs authorities worldwide have promoted electronic customs-clearance procedures to cope with increasing cargo flow, which has constructed the initial prototype of the PCS. With rapid advancements in information technology, the PCS functionalities nowadays have significantly expanded to encompass real-time monitoring of liners, terminals, trucks, and containers; electronic customs declarations; data analytics; and cargo tracking. Through data-collection mechanisms and blockchain technology, the sector can access comprehensive logistics data, enabling detailed analyses of cargo flow trends and precise demand forecasting. Moreover, cargo owners can track cargo status with the platform around the clock so as to reduce management costs and further streamline and optimise the supply chain structure. In addition, trading partners and financing banks may also verify trade information through the platform to minimise risks associated with erroneous lending.

Commerce as Pioneer, Government as Leader to Overcome Sector’s Barriers

Obviously, the existing smart logistics platforms of the sector have already possessed certain functionalities of the PCS. Nonetheless, examining the development process of the platforms reveals that the success or failure of a smart port platform largely hinges on its attractiveness to encourage extensive industry participation and stakeholder engagement, thereby enabling the full establishment of the community system. Given the considerable volume of sensitive commercial information including in logistics data, many industry-led logistics community systems in the past encountered difficulties in securing the trust of other enterprises. For instance, the digital logistics platform TradeLens, jointly launched by European shipping firm Maersk and IBM in 2018, ceased operations two years ago due to inadequate involvement from industry stakeholders.

It is believed that the significance of the Government-led PCS lies not in functional innovation, but rather in promoting the broader adoption of smart logistics  —— handling commercially sensitive data with a higher degree of neutrality and confidentiality, the Government can break barriers in between. If the Government-developed PCS establishes a confidential, secure, and reliable mechanism for information exchange among the platforms in the sector, and incorporate structural flexibility to accommodate interfaces with diverse systems, it will likely attract the sector to exchange information through the PCS, and resolve the current impasse.

Add Revenue Sources via Value-added Services; Collaborate with the Commerce to Promote Smart Logistics

Moreover, given the current constraints on public finance, the PCS platform must achieve long-term break even. Noteworthily, many successful platforms typically offer their services free during the initial stages to attract sufficient users and traffic. For instance, the Mainland’s National Public Information Platform for Transportation and Logistics (LOGINK) has been providing enterprises with free services and has already brought over 400,000 enterprises nationwide into the platform. It can be observed that the success of such systems depends largely upon their prevalence and degree of industry adoption. Basic services must, therefore, be provided without charge.

However, to alleviate the burden on public finance, it is suggested that the authorities examine the possibility of incorporating fee-charging value-added services into the platform, such as artificial intelligence software, which supports users in data analysis, the investigation of competitors, supply-chain optimisation, and financial risk management.

It is additionally anticipated that the authorities will seize this opportunity to enhance the promotion of smart logistics applications, including electronic bills of lading (eBL). Escalating international political tensions and fickleness of trade and tariff policies have brought supply-chain intellectualisation onto the agenda. For example, Presidency of Donald Trump of the United State (US) previously suspended tariff exemptions for goods valued below USD 800, substantially increasing customs-clearance procedures. Consequently, millions of shipments accumulated at customs checkpoints and imposed significant burdens and disruptions on cargo owners, logistics providers, and even the US customs. Although the US authorities promptly reinstated the original exemptions, this incident underscored the escalating risks associated with trade policies.

It is noticed that eBL technology can not only expedites the process of cargo collection, but also automatically generates documentation required for customs clearance, effectively mitigating the risk of delays caused by the fickleness of trade and tariff policies. As e-commerce platforms expand overseas, the full application of eBL across air, land, and maritime transport will significantly enhance the resilience of enterprises’ supply chains.

The authorities are recommended to strengthen collaboration with other platforms in the industry to promote diverse smart logistics solutions, for supporting the local logistics sector in responding to future uncertainties. The authorities should also endeavour to achieve seamless integration between various systems in system design, collaboration, promotion, and other areas,  and actively broaden the scope of cooperation partners to connect with countries and regions along the Belt and Road through the application of the Internet of Things, facilitating data flow of logistics, information, and capital among Hong Kong, the Mainland, and Belt and Road countries, and thus creating business opportunities for local logistics, finance, information technology, and service industries.

In summary, not only is the establishment of the PCS a critical measure to bridge the logistics sector's "information silos", but it is also an instrumental initiative to promote industry intellectualization and enhance competitiveness, ultimately fostering the prominent role of Hong Kong’s logistics sector in global competition.
